Pack appropriately<\/strong><\/h2>\n<p>You don\u2019t need to pack too many clothes when visiting an <a href=\"https:\/\/www.tripcentral.ca\/all-inclusive-vacations\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">all-inclusive<\/a> resort, though there are some items \u2013 like a swim suit and formal dinner wear \u2013 that you shouldn\u2019t forget. No matter how many you own, you do not need to bring five swim suits (in fact, the more consistent you are, the less conflicting the tan lines). You do not need that hair straightener (you won\u2019t use it with the humidity \u2013 and what for? You\u2019ll be getting your hair\u00a0wet every day). Men, make sure you have long pants and a collared shirt for the a la carte restaurants.\u00a0Always bring <a href=\"https:\/\/www.tripcentral.ca\/blog\/travel-with-carry-on-bag\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">carry-on luggage<\/a> with the necessities and a couple of outfits in case your checked <a href=\"https:\/\/www.tripcentral.ca\/blog\/8-lessons-losing-luggage\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">luggage is lost<\/a> or delayed. Cross packing with your travel partner is one way to lessen the impact if this happens. Divide your clothes between two suitcases, so if one goes missing, you each have something to work with.<\/p>\n<h2><strong>2. Wear sunscreen<\/strong><\/h2>\n<p><img decoding=\"async\" loading=\"lazy\" class=\"aligncenter wp-image-15531\" src=\"http:\/\/www.tripcentral.ca\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2015\/07\/Daughter-and-mother-in-beach-with-sunscreen_94299556-1024x683.jpg\" alt=\"Daughter and mother in beach with sunscreen_94299556\" width=\"800\" height=\"533\" srcset=\"https:\/\/www.tripcentral.ca\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2015\/07\/Daughter-and-mother-in-beach-with-sunscreen_94299556-1024x683.jpg 1024w, https:\/\/www.tripcentral.ca\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2015\/07\/Daughter-and-mother-in-beach-with-sunscreen_94299556-300x200.jpg 300w, https:\/\/www.tripcentral.ca\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2015\/07\/Daughter-and-mother-in-beach-with-sunscreen_94299556-768x512.jpg 768w, https:\/\/www.tripcentral.ca\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2015\/07\/Daughter-and-mother-in-beach-with-sunscreen_94299556-140x94.jpg 140w\" sizes=\"(max-width: 800px) 100vw, 800px\" \/><\/p>\n<p>This one is so important. A sunburn can seriously ruin your vacation, considering you paid to lay on the beach in the sun, not to mention be extremely painful and harm your skin, and last weeks after you return. The peak of the sun\u2019s strength is between 11a.m. to 4p.m., so try and choose indoor activities or take that relaxing siesta during this period. Apply <a href=\"https:\/\/www.tripcentral.ca\/blog\/sunscreen-tips\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">sunscreen<\/a> every two hours you are outdoors and again after swimming. Don\u2019t overlook the top of your feet and ears. Those prone to burns may want to wear sun-protective clothing and swim suits. Look for a sunscreen with both UVA and UVB ray protection (called broad spectrum) and bring it from home rather than splurging at the resort.<\/p>\n<h2><strong>3. Bring small bills for tipping<\/strong><\/h2>\n<p>If you\u2019re going to a resort, it\u2019s easier if you bring small bills with you for tipping so you aren\u2019t trying to find change while you\u2019re there. Tips are greatly appreciated in the Caribbean and a way of saying thank you to the locals who work hard to make your stay comfortable and enjoyable. Tips are accepted in the local currency (and most beneficial to the workers) but also American dollars in Mexico and Canadian dollars in the Dominican Republic. You may even want to bring <a href=\"http:\/\/www.tripcentral.ca\/blog\/things-to-bring-to-cuba\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">small gifts<\/a> for the locals when visiting Cuba. Remember, Cuba\u2019s currency cannot be exchanged internationally, so you\u2019ll have to convert your Canadian money into CUC (the Cuban Convertible Peso) at the airport or your hotel and remember to convert it back to Canadian dollars before you board the plane back home.<\/p>\n<p>What are your lessons learned from <a href=\"http:\/\/www.tripcentral.ca\/vacations-packages_caribbean.html\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">Caribbean vacations<\/a>?<\/p>\n","protected":false},"excerpt":{"rendered":"<p>Sunshine, soft sands, and sultry Latin music lured me in and I left wanting more of the strawberry daiquiris and exhilarating zip lines.
